If the marketplace goes down, you obtain the ensured return, generally something between 0 and 3%. Naturally, because it's an insurance plan, there are likewise the usual prices of insurance policy, compensations, and surrender fees to pay. The information, and the factors that returns are so horrible when mixing insurance coverage and investing in this particular means, come down to generally 3 things: They just pay you for the return of the index, and not the returns.

Universal Life Insurance Single Premium

Your maximum return is capped. If you cap is 10%, and the return of the S&P 500 index fund is 30% (like last year), you get 10%, not 30%. Some policies just offer a specific percentage of the change in the index, say 80%. So if the Index Fund rises 12%, and 2% of that is returns, the change in the index is 10%.

Add all these impacts with each other, and you'll discover that long-term returns on index global life are rather darn near to those for entire life insurance policy, positive, yet low. Yes, these plans ensure that the cash money worth (not the cash that goes to the costs of insurance, of program) will certainly not shed money, yet there is no assurance it will stay on top of rising cost of living, much less expand at the price you require it to expand at in order to offer for your retirement.

Koreis's 16 factors: An indexed global life policy account worth can never ever lose money due to a down market. Indexed universal life insurance policy assurances your account value, securing in gains from each year, called an annual reset.

In investing, you earn money to take risk. If you don't intend to take much threat, do not anticipate high returns. IUL account values grow tax-deferred like a qualified plan (IRA and 401(k)); mutual funds do not unless they are held within a qualified strategy. Merely put, this implies that your account value gain from triple compounding: You gain rate of interest on your principal, you gain rate of interest on your passion and you earn interest accurate you would certainly or else have actually paid in tax obligations on the rate of interest.

Qualified strategies are a much better option than non-qualified strategies, they still have problems not present with an IUL. Financial investment selections are usually restricted to common funds where your account value goes through wild volatility from direct exposure to market danger. There is a big distinction between a tax-deferred pension and an IUL, but Mr.

You invest in one with pre-tax dollars, minimizing this year's tax obligation costs at your low tax obligation rate (and will often be able to withdraw your money at a reduced effective price later) while you purchase the various other with after-tax bucks and will be forced to pay passion to borrow your very own cash if you do not wish to surrender the plan.

After that he includes the traditional IUL sales person scare method of "wild volatility." If you hate volatility, there are much better means to reduce it than by getting an IUL, like diversity, bonds or low-beta stocks. There are no limitations on the quantity that might be contributed yearly to an IUL.
